Baseball Recap: Central Lions vs. Lee-Scott Academy Warriors
Central has relied on a stalwart pitchers averaging 3.76 runs allowed per game, but that average took a hit on Wednesday. They fell just short of the Lee-Scott Academy Warriors by a score of 11-9. The Lions just can't catch a break and have now endured four losses in a row.
Central's defeat dropped their record down to 20-5. As for Lee-Scott Academy, they are on a roll lately: they've won 14 of their last 17 matches. That's provided a nice bump to their 20-10 record this season.
Central will look to defend their home field on Thursday against South Paulding at 5:30 p.m. The Spartans will roll in looking for their eighth straight victory, something the Lions surely won't give up without a fight. As for Lee-Scott Academy, they will take on Marbury at 4:30 p.m. on Friday.
